The present work proposes an application of Soft Rough Set and its span for unsupervised keyword extraction. In recent times Soft Rough Sets are being applied in various domains, though none of its applications are in the area of keyword extraction. On the other hand, the concept of Rough Set based span has been developed for improved efficiency in the domain of extractive text summarization. In this work we amalgamate these two techniques, called Soft Rough Set based Span (SRS), to provide an effective solution for keyword extraction from texts. The universe for Soft Rough Set is taken to be a collection of words from the input texts. SRS provides an ideal platform for identifying the set of keywords from the input text which cannot always be defined clearly and unambiguously. The proposed technique uses greedy algorithm for computing spanning sets. The experimental results suggest that extraction of keywords using the proposed scheme gives consistent results across different domains. Also, it has been found to be more efficient in comparison with several existing unsupervised techniques.

The aim of this paper is to introduce the concepts of soft rough q-rung orthopair fuzzy set (SRqROFS) and q-rung orthopair fuzzy soft rough set (qROPFSRS) based on soft rough set and fuzzy soft relation, respectively. We define some fundamental operations on both SRqROFS and qROPFSRS and discuss some key properties of these models by using upper and lower approximation operators. The suggested models are superior than existing soft rough sets, intuitionistic fuzzy soft rough sets and Pythagorean fuzzy soft rough sets. These models are more efficient to deal with vagueness in multi-criteria decision-making (MCDM) problems. We develop Algorithm i (i = 1, 2, 3, 4, 5) for the construction of SRqROFS, construction of qROFSRS, selection of a smart phone, ranking of beautiful public parks, and ranking of government challenges, respectively. The notions of upper reduct and lower reduct based on the upper approximations and lower approximations by variation of the decision attributes are also proposed. The applications of the proposed MCDM methods are demonstrated by respective numerical examples. The idea of core is used to find a unanimous optimal decision which is obtained by taking the intersection of all lower reducts and upper reducts.

Abstract Rough set is a very powerful invention to the whole world for dealing with uncertain, incomplete and imprecise problems. Also soft set theory and neutrosophic set theory both are advance mathematical tools to handle these uncertain, incomplete, inconsistent information in a better way. The purpose of this article is to expand the scope of rough set, soft set and neutrosophic set theory. We have introduced the concept of neutrosophic soft set with roughness without using full soft set. Some definition, properties and examples have been established on neutrosophic soft rough set. Moreover, dispensable and equalities are written on roughness with neutrosophic soft set.

Linguistic variable is an effective method of representation the preferences of a decision-maker for inaccuracy available information in decision making under uncertainty. This article investigates a multiple attribute ranking decision making problem with linguistic preference by using linguistic value soft rough set. Firstly, we present the definition of linguistic value fuzzy set by introduce the concept of linguistic variable into the original Zadeh’s fuzzy set. We then define the concept of linguistic value soft set and the pseudo linguistic value soft set over the alternative set and parameter set of discourse. Moreover, we investigate the basic operators and the mathematical properties of the linguistic value soft set. Subsequently, we establish the rough approximation of an uncertainty concept with linguistic value over the object set and parameter set, i.e., the linguistic value soft rough set model. Meanwhile, we discuss several deformations of the linguistic value soft rough lower and upper approximations as well as some fundamental properties of the linguistic value soft approximation operators. With reference on the exploring of the fundamental of linguistic value soft rough set, we construct a new method for handling with the multiple attribute ranking decision making problems with linguistic information by combining the proposed soft rough set and the VIKOR method. Then, we give the detailed decision procedure and steps for the established decision approach. At last, an extensive numerical example is further conducted to illustrate the process of the decision making principle and the results are satisfactory. The main contribution of this paper is twofold. One is to provide a new model of granular computing by infusion the soft set and rough set theory with linguistic valued information. Another is to try making a new way to handle multiple attribute decision making problems based on linguistic value soft rough set and the VIKOR method.

Bipolar soft sets and rough sets are two different techniques to cope with uncertainty. A possible fusion of rough sets and bipolar soft sets is proposed by Karaaslan and Çağman. They introduced the notion of bipolar soft rough set. In this article, a new technique is being introduced to study roughness through bipolar soft sets. In this new technique of finding approximations of a set, flavour of both theories of bipolar soft set and rough set is retained. We call this new hybrid model modified rough bipolar soft set MRBS-set. Moreover, accuracy measure and roughness measure of modified rough bipolar soft sets are defined in MRBS-approximation space and its application in multi-criteria group decision making is presented.
